Gravity Error, released in 2015, is an intriguing indie 2D puzzle/platformer that challenges players to manipulate gravity while guiding the character Force through a variety of creatively designed levels. With its focus on emotional themes, this game invites players to navigate a world where avoiding crushing obstacles is just as important as solving complex puzzles. The unique gravity-shifting mechanic sets it apart from conventional platformers, providing a fresh twist for puzzle enthusiasts.
